About this app

E-Grid is the companion app for motorsport fans who follow more than one series. Subscribe to the championships you love and get everything in one clean, fast app: schedules, countdowns, reminders, standings, results and news.

CHANNELS, NOT CLUTTER
Pick your series — Formula 1, MotoGP, the NASCAR Cup Series, IndyCar, Formula E, the World Rally Championship, the World Endurance Championship (including the 24 Hours of Le Mans), IMSA (including Petit Le Mans), NHRA Drag Racing, Formula 2, Formula 3, the Porsche Mobil 1 Supercup and the Clio Cup Series — thirteen channels at launch, with more on the way. From the biggest championships to the one-make cups the paddock loves, your home screen shows only what you follow, with the next race always front and centre.

Where a series publishes full data, you get standings and results; where it doesn't, we say so and give you the calendar, countdowns, reminders and news — we would rather under-promise than pretend.

NEVER MISS LIGHTS OUT
A live countdown to the next race, every session time in your local time zone, and optional reminders one hour before the start plus a race-morning nudge. Set it once and forget the timetable.

FULL SEASON CALENDAR
Every round of every series you follow, grouped by month, in one combined calendar. See at a glance when the next race weekend is — and when two of your series clash.

CHAMPIONSHIP STANDINGS
Follow the title fight with F1 driver and constructor standings plus the full classification from the last Grand Prix, MotoGP rider standings, and Formula E driver standings — updated after every round.

GO DEEPER ON EVERY RACE
Tap any race for a full page: session times, where to watch in your country, circuit facts, history and a stylised track layout. Formula 1 race pages add tyre strategy — every driver's stint sequence and compounds — plus track and air temperature from the race itself.

DRIVERS, TEAMS AND MACHINES
Tap any name in the standings for a biography, career highlights and live season stats. Teams, constructors and manufacturers come with chassis, power unit and the season's technical regulations.

ALL YOUR NEWS IN ONE FEED
Headlines from leading motorsport publications, merged into a single feed and filterable by series. Tap through to read the full story at the source.

KNOW THE RULES
Quick links to the FIA sporting regulations for each championship, so you can settle any argument about penalties, points or parc fermé.

E-GRID PREMIUM
The free plan includes one channel with news, calendar and standings. Premium unlocks:
• Unlimited channels — follow every series
• Race reminders and race-day notifications
• Full standings, results and stats

Premium is a monthly subscription with your first month free, or a yearly plan at better value. Prices are shown in your own currency before you buy, and you can cancel any time in the Play Store under Subscriptions.

BUILT FOR THE DARK
Full dark mode — because most races are best watched with the lights down.

What’s new

FIXED
Opening a finished Formula 1 session during a race weekend could show "Timing locked during live running" instead of the results - even for last weekend's race. Our timing provider locks all of its data while any F1 session is running, which is exactly when you are most likely to look.

Race, qualifying and sprint results now come from a second source when that happens, so they are there all weekend. Practice times return once the session on track has finished.
